Chicago Cubs @ Pittsburgh Pirates

1961-04-19 Β· Night game Β· Forbes Field Β· Att: 12742 Β· 42Β°F, night, dry Β· 2:24

Pittsburgh Pirates defeated Chicago Cubs 4–1. Pittsburgh Pirates put up 3 in the 6th. Bob Friend earned the win. Ernie Banks went 1-for-4 with 1 HR and 1 RBI.
